Boxlight Reports Second Quarter 2020 Results

Boxlight Corporation (Nasdaq: BOXL) (“Boxlight”), a leading provider of interactive technology solutions for the global education market, today announced the Company's financial results for the first quarter ended June 30, 2020.

Key Financial Highlights for Q2 2020

  • Revenues decreased by 28% to $7.8 million
  • Customer orders decreased by 55% to $6.4 million
  • Gross profit increased by 670 basis points to 34%
  • Operating expenses decreased by 17% to $3.5 million
  • Operating loss decreased by 36% to $0.8 million
  • Net loss was even at $1.4 million
  • EPS loss decreased by 40% to $(0.08)
  • Adjusted EBITDA loss decreased by 69% to $0.3 million
  • Adjusted EPS decreased by 81% to loss of $0.01
  • Ended quarter with $2.5 million in backlog orders
  • Working capital improved by 175% to $3.8 million
  • Stockholders’ equity improved by 1,757% to $10.7 million

Financial Results for the Three Months Ended June 30, 2020

Revenue for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$7.8 million, a decrease of $3.0 million or 28%, compared to $10.8 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019. Revenue loss reflects decreased sales volume primarily related to school closures as a result of COVID-19.

Gross profit for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$2.7 million, a decrease of $0.3 million, compared to $3.0 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019. The resulting gross margin was 34.4% for the three months ended June 30, 2020, compared to 27.7% for the three months ended June 30, 2019.

General and Administrative expenses for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$3.2 million, a decrease of $0.7 million or 18%, compared to $3.9 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019. The decrease was primarily driven by reductions in tradeshow expense and contract services.

Research and development expenses for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$0.3 million, a decrease of 12%, compared to $0.3 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019. The decrease was primarily driven by a decrease in contract services and salaries.

Operating loss for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$0.8 million, a decrease of $0.4 million, or 36%, compared to $1.2 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019.

Other expense for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was expense of $0.6 million, as compared to an expense of $0.2 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019. The increase in other expense is related to the change in fair value of derivative liability of $0.3 million and increased interest expense of $0.1 million.

Net loss for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$1.4 million remaining flat compared to $1.4 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019. The resulting EPS loss for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$(0.08) per diluted share, compared to $(0.13) per diluted share for the three months ended June 30, 2019.

Adjusted EBITDA loss for the three months ended June 30, 2020 was $0.3 million, a decrease of $0.5 million or 69% compared to $0.8 million for the three months ended June 30, 2019.

At June 30, 2020, Boxlight had $6.1 million of cash, $28.1 million of total assets, $7.1 debt, and 31.9 million shares issued and outstanding.

Financial Results for the Six Months Ended June 30, 2020

Rev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was $13.6 million, a decrease of $2.2 million or 14%, compared to $15.8 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019.

Gross profit for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was $4.3 million, a decrease of $0.4 million, compared to $4.7 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019. The resulting gross margin was 31.6% for the six months ended June 30, 2020, compared to 29.5% for the six months ended June 30, 2019.

General and administrative expenses for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was $7.1 million, a decrease of $0.6 million or 7%, compared to $7.7 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019. The decrease was primarily related to reductions in tradeshows and contract services offset by an increase in commissions.

Research and development expenses for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was $0.6 million, an increase of 7%, compared to $0.6 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019. The increase was primarily related to an increase in contract services offset by a decrease in salaries.

Operating loss for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was $3.5 million, a decrease of $0.1 million, or 3%, compared to $3.6 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019.

Other income (expense) for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was income of $0.1 million, as compared to an expense of $2.5 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019. The increase in other income is related to a gain on settlement of accounts payable $1.7 million, change in fair value of derivative liability $1.8 million offset by a loss on settlement of debt of $0.6 million and increased interest expense of $0.3 million.

Net loss for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was $3.4 million, a decrease of $2.6 million or 44%, compared to $6.0 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019. The resulting EPS loss for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was ($0.22) per diluted share, compared to ($0.58) per diluted share for the six months ended June 30, 2019.

Adjusted EBITDA loss for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was $1.3 million, a decrease of $1.3 million compared to $2.6 million for the six months ended June 30, 2019.

Adjusted EPS for the six months ended June 30, 2020 was ($0.09) per diluted share, compared to ($0.25) per diluted share for the six months ended June 30, 2019.

Use of Non-GAAP Financial Measures

To supplement Boxlight’s financial statements presented on a GAAP basis, Boxlight provides EBITDA and Adjusted EBITDA as supplemental measures of its performance.

To provide investors with additional insight and allow for a more comprehensive understanding of the information used by management in its financial and decision-making surrounding pro forma operations, we supplement our consolidated financial statements presented on a basis consistent with U.S. generally accepted accounting principles, or GAAP, with EBITDA and Adjusted EBITDA, non-GAAP financial measures of earnings. EBITDA represents net income before income tax expense (benefit), interest expense, depreciation and amortization. Adjusted EBITDA represents EBITDA plus stock-based compensation and change in fair value of derivative liabilities. Our management uses EBITDA and Adjusted EBITDA as financial measures to evaluate the profitability and efficiency of our business model. We use these non-GAAP financial measures to access the strength of the underlying operations of our business. These adjustments, and the non-GAAP financial measures that are derived from them, provide supplemental information to analyze our operations between periods and over time. We find this especially useful when reviewing pro forma results of operations, which include large non-cash amortizations of intangible assets from acquisitions and stock-based compensation. Investors should consider our non-GAAP financial measures in addition to, and not as a substitute for, financial measures prepared in accordance with GAAP.
